Here is what I would do if I was in the Senate:

- Vote against all Trump nominees
- Deny unanimous consent to slow senate proceedings
- Vote no on all cloture
- Force quorum calls at every chance

Democrats hands aren't totally tied. They just don't want to play dirty. I could literally do it alone
